Definitions:

Depreciation Expense

An accounting method of allocating the cost of a tangible asset over its useful life, representing how much of the asset's value has been used up.

CCA Class

CCA Class refers to the Canadian Capital Cost Allowance system where assets are categorized for the purpose of depreciation calculation for tax purposes.
